Subject: Cut-over complete — Hookmill retry semantics

Hi on-call,

The Hookmill cut-over finished at 02:10. Webhook deliveries now use exponential backoff with jitter instead of fixed intervals, and dead-lettering kicks in after the final attempt rather than silently dropping. Consumers at Bramfeld verified receipt ordering. Watch the retry-depth dashboard for the next 24 hours. For reference during any incident, the current production configuration values are as follows.

deployment values, yadug-bawif:
[framir]
team = pelox
access_code = ac_a38ab2
owner = tamion.julael
host = framir.tolvaqlabs.test
port = 11211
peer = tammir.zemvargrid.local
salt = 2215ef03
pin = 1541

Handover: TilePuller prefetcher

Passing TilePuller to you before the 4.2 cut. It's mostly stable, but the prefetch radius config was bumped last sprint and cache fill now takes ~20 min after deploy — don't flag the cold-cache latency spike as a regression. One open issue: zoom level 14 occasionally double-fetches; harmless but noisy in metrics. Everything I know, including the tuning history, is written up here.

operations page: https://jenkins.zemvarcloud.local/job/merge_requests/repo/build/73930b4b30f0a8ed

While the Ketterbrook campus is under renovation, all visitors report to the temporary site at Farrow Yard. The facilities desk should issue day passes only after checking visitors against the expected-arrivals list supplied each morning by the Norrland Projects team. Escorts are required beyond the marshalling area at all times. For staff covering the desk, the door-pass code for the Farrow Yard side entrance is given below.

turnstile pass: bdg-QZV-3

Minutes — Management Meeting, Capacity Decision

Attendees: operations, finance, plant leadership. Short version for the finance team: the Brindlemoor factory is running at 94% capacity and Jora made the case that adding a third shift beats building out Line 4 this year. Cost modelling from Pell's group supports that, assuming the Averlane order book holds. We agreed to defer capex until Q2 and revisit. Budget implications to follow in the forecast pack. The confidential outline of where we're heading is noted below.

confidential, kagup-bafog: Fraaxax Group is in early talks to buy Soroxox Group for about $343.8 million. The Olidor launch date is June 14, and nothing goes to the press before then. Legal wants the Aldmirek Logistics term sheet signed before July 23.